The Baton Rouge City Court Probation Division wish to offer our sincerest condolences to the families, friends and colleagues of Corporal Scotty Canezaro who was killed in a helicopter crash in a field off North Winterville Road, near U.S. 190 at Erwinville, at about 2:26 pm. He and his fellow officers paid the ultimate price while simply performing their duty. Our hearts go out to you all.

It is at times such as these law-enforcement both serving and retired are reminded of the dangers of the job. Our prayer is to encourage and bring uplift to the families, men and women who serve as Baton Rouge Police Officers and the city at-large. With Honor He Served!
